September 11, 2001 – In Memoriam

On September 11, 2001, my husband lost his childhood best friend to the terrorist attacks.  David Tengelin was an accountant with Marsh & McLennan on the 100th floor of the North Tower of the WTC.  His building was the first hit and, given that he was on the 100th floor, he never had a chance to get out.  Regretfully, I never knew David, but from all the stories that I’ve heard and read, he was an extraordinary person.

R.I.P. David – to the best friend I’ll never know.
